Purpose and Benefits of the Health Professions Student Loan Application
The primary purpose of the HPSL is to provide financial support to students enrolled in health professions. This loan offers significant benefits, including a fixed 5% interest rate and repayment terms that commence after graduation or withdrawal from the program. This structure alleviates immediate financial burdens, allowing students to focus on their studies without the stress of large debts.

What is the interest rate on loans obtained through this application?
Loans obtained through the Health Professions Student Loan Application feature a fixed interest rate of 5%, making it a beneficial option for eligible borrowers.
